What exactly is DuPont™ Solid Surface? At its core, it’s a composite material composed of acrylic polymers and alumina trihydrate (ATH), derived from bauxite ore. This unique formulation bestows upon it a remarkable set of characteristics that set it apart from traditional materials like granite, marble, laminate, or even quartz. One of its most celebrated attributes is its non-porous nature. Unlike natural stone, which can absorb liquids and harbor bacteria, DuPont™ Solid Surface is completely impermeable. This means spills are easily wiped away, stains have little to no chance of penetrating, and maintaining a hygienic environment is effortlessly achieved. This makes it an ideal choice for kitchens, where food preparation is a daily ritual, and for healthcare settings where sanitation is non-negotiable.

Beyond its hygienic properties, the seamless nature of DuPont™ Solid Surface is a design game-changer. Because it can be glued together with a special adhesive that, once cured, becomes virtually invisible, fabricators can create installations that appear as a single, monolithic piece. This means no unsightly seams or grout lines to trap dirt and detract from the overall aesthetic. Imagine a kitchen island that flows seamlessly from countertop to waterfall edge, or a reception desk that presents an uninterrupted expanse of elegant material. This seamless integration not only looks sophisticated but also simplifies cleaning and maintenance, further enhancing its practicality.

The versatility of DuPont™ Solid Surface extends to its incredible workability. Unlike stone, which requires specialized cutting and shaping techniques, solid surface can be cut, routed, sanded, and thermoformed. Thermoforming is a particularly fascinating process where the material can be heated and bent into curves and complex shapes, opening up a vast landscape of design possibilities. This ability to be molded and shaped allows for bespoke designs that are impossible with other materials. Think of intricate backsplashes, custom-molded sinks integrated directly into the countertop, or even artistic sculptural elements. This inherent flexibility empowers designers and homeowners to move beyond conventional forms and create truly unique spaces.

Furthermore, DuPont™ Solid Surface is renowned for its durability and repairability. While resistant to everyday wear and tear, scratches or minor damage can occur. However, unlike many other materials, these imperfections can often be easily repaired by sanding or buffing the surface, restoring it to its original pristine condition. This means that your investment in DuPont™ Solid Surface will continue to look stunning for years to come, without the need for costly replacements. This inherent longevity and ease of repair contribute significantly to its long-term value proposition.

The aesthetic appeal of DuPont™ Solid Surface is another compelling reason for its widespread popularity. It is available in an extensive palette of colors, patterns, and textures, mimicking everything from the subtle veining of natural marble to the solid, bold hues that can define a modern design. Whether your style leans towards minimalist chic, rustic charm, or bold contemporary statements, there is a DuPont™ Solid Surface option to complement your vision. The ability to customize edges, integrate sinks and backsplashes, and achieve seamless transitions further enhances its design potential, allowing for a truly tailored look.

The process of finding a reputable manufacturer or fabricator typically involves a few key steps. Firstly, leverage the official resources provided by DuPont. Their website often features a “Find a Pro” or “Authorized Fabricator” locator tool, which is an invaluable resource for identifying certified professionals in your area. These locators are designed to connect you with individuals and companies that have undergone specific training and meet DuPont’s stringent quality requirements.

Secondly, don’t hesitate to ask for recommendations. If you know someone who has recently undergone a renovation and used solid surface, ask about their experience and if they can recommend their fabricator. Word-of-mouth referrals can be incredibly reliable. Similarly, interior designers and architects are excellent sources for finding skilled professionals. They often have a network of trusted fabricators they work with regularly.

When you begin reaching out to potential manufacturers, be prepared to discuss your project in detail. Have a clear idea of the application (kitchen countertop, bathroom vanity, reception desk, etc.), the desired dimensions, any specific design features you envision (e.g., integrated sink, waterfall edge, specific edge profile), and your preferred color or finish. The more information you can provide upfront, the more accurately they can provide a quote and advise you on the best DuPont™ Solid Surface options for your needs.

It’s also prudent to inquire about their experience specifically with DuPont™ Solid Surface. While a fabricator might work with various solid surface brands, a specialization in DuPont™ ensures they are intimately familiar with its unique properties and fabrication techniques. Ask about their warranty offerings, both on the material itself and their workmanship. A reputable fabricator will stand behind their work.

Requesting samples of the actual DuPont™ Solid Surface materials you are considering is a vital step. Seeing and touching the samples in your own space, under your lighting conditions, will give you a much better understanding of how the color and pattern will translate into your finished project. Don’t be afraid to ask for detailed quotes that break down the costs of the material, fabrication, installation, and any additional features. Transparency in pricing is a hallmark of a trustworthy business.

Finally, consider the communication and responsiveness of the fabricator. A good working relationship is built on clear and timely communication. If a fabricator is difficult to reach or evasive with information, it might be a sign to look elsewhere. When discussing your project, be specific about your needs. For kitchen countertops, consider the layout, the number of sinks, the need for integrated cutting boards or drainboard grooves, and the desired edge profile. For bathroom vanities, think about the sink type (undermount, integrated), faucet placement, and any custom storage solutions. For commercial applications, discuss the anticipated traffic, hygiene requirements, and branding considerations. The fabricator’s ability to offer creative solutions and anticipate potential challenges is a strong indicator of their expertise.

A critical aspect of the consultation is discussing the fabrication process itself. Understand how they handle templating (creating precise measurements of your space), cutting, shaping, seaming, and finishing. For DuPont™ Solid Surface, the ability to achieve near-invisible seams is a key selling point. Ask them about their methods for achieving this and what adhesives they use. The finishing process is also important; solid surface can be finished in various sheens, from matte to high gloss. Discuss which finish would be most suitable for your application and how to maintain it.

For integrated sinks, discuss the options available. DuPont™ Solid Surface can be seamlessly integrated with sinks made from the same material, creating a cohesive and hygienic look. Alternatively, they can be fabricated to accommodate undermount stainless steel, ceramic, or other sink types. The fabricator can guide you on the best choices for your specific needs and aesthetic preferences.

When it comes to pricing, always request a detailed, itemized quote. This should clearly outline the cost of the DuPont™ Solid Surface material, fabrication labor, any special edge details, sink integration, transportation, and installation. Be wary of quotes that are significantly lower than others; it might indicate a compromise in quality or materials. Transparency in pricing is a sign of a reputable business.

After you’ve chosen a fabricator, maintain open communication throughout the process. The templating phase is critical for accuracy. Ensure you are present or have a trusted representative present during templating to confirm measurements and discuss any last-minute details. Similarly, be available or have someone present during the installation to address any questions or concerns that may arise.

The installation of DuPont™ Solid Surface is typically a straightforward process for experienced fabricators. They will carefully transport the fabricated pieces to your location and meticulously install them, ensuring proper support and adhesion. They will also perform any necessary on-site adjustments or finishing touches. Once installed, they should provide you with clear instructions on how to care for and maintain your new solid surface. This typically involves simple cleaning with mild soap and water and avoiding abrasive cleaners or harsh chemicals that could potentially damage the surface.
